Ticket AURA-902 — Contrast audit, Wrenlight dashboard. Automated sweep flagged 14 components below the 4.5:1 threshold, mostly muted labels on the slate theme and disabled-state buttons. All fixed in the tokens layer; no per-component overrides. Two chart palettes remain borderline and are deferred to next cycle with sign-off from design. Safe to include in the release candidate. The verified build carries the token below.

trace token, taguf-yajop: htk6_3fef6e

Subject: Handover — Glimmercache memory leak

Handing off the Glimmercache issue. Heap grows roughly 40 MB/hour under normal load; evicted thumbnails aren't being released because the decode buffer holds a reference. My draft fix is in branch `fix/evict-release`, awaiting review. Load test results are attached to the ticket. Questions about the patch can go to the address below.

pager mailbox: druwyn@norvaio.corp

**Handover: Baseline File Ownership — Merrowcode**

Handing the Merrowcode static-analysis baseline over to you before the 4.2 cut. The baseline lives in the repo root; regenerate only when Scanlight upgrades, never to hide new findings. Triage queue is clean as of today. The baseline signing account occasionally locks after CI retries; if that happens during the release, recover it with the passphrase that follows:

unlock words, hahip-baduf: holwyn-istath-julvan